Understanding High-Efficiency Steam Gas Boilers
High-efficiency steam gas boilers are designed to convert natural gas or other gaseous fuels into steam. They utilize advanced combustion technology and heat recovery systems to maximize energy output while minimizing fuel consumption. The primary goal of these boilers is to produce steam that meets specific pressure and temperature requirements for various applications, including heating, power generation, and industrial processes.
The efficiency of these boilers is typically measured in terms of thermal efficiency, which indicates the ratio of useful energy output to energy input. High-efficiency models can achieve thermal efficiencies of over 90%, significantly outperforming traditional boilers that often operate at 70% to 80% efficiency.
Key Features of High-Efficiency Steam Gas Boilers
1. Enhanced Heat Exchangers High-efficiency boilers are equipped with advanced heat exchanger designs, which maximize heat transfer while minimizing heat losses. Features like condensing heat exchangers reclaim waste heat, further improving overall efficiency.
2. Modulating Burners These boilers often use modulating burners that adjust the fuel-air mixture based on the steam demand. This capability not only enhances efficiency but also reduces emissions by ensuring optimal combustion conditions.
3. Smart Technology Integration Many high-efficiency steam gas boilers incorporate smart monitoring and control systems. These systems enable real-time data analysis and remote monitoring, helping operators optimize performance and promptly address any issues.
4. Low NOx Emissions Environmental regulations are becoming increasingly stringent, and high-efficiency steam gas boilers are designed to emit significantly lower levels of nitrogen oxides (NOx). This is achieved through advanced burner technology and combustion techniques that minimize excess air and optimize fuel mixing.
5. Robust Construction These boilers are typically constructed from high-grade materials that enhance durability and resistance to wear and tear, which translates into lower maintenance costs and longer lifespans.
Benefits of High-Efficiency Steam Gas Boilers
1. Cost Savings The superior efficiency of these boilers leads to reduced fuel consumption, translating into significant cost savings over time. Businesses can expect lower energy bills, which directly impacts their bottom line.
2. Environmental Impact By reducing fuel consumption and emissions, high-efficiency steam gas boilers contribute to a smaller carbon footprint, helping businesses comply with environmental regulations and sustainability goals.
3. Reliability and Performance High-efficiency boilers are designed for maximum uptime, providing reliable steam generation for critical applications. The advanced technology integrated into these systems ensures consistent performance, even under varying load conditions.
4. Versatility of Application These boilers are suitable for a wide range of applications, from small commercial boilers to large industrial steam supply systems. Their flexibility allows businesses across multiple sectors, including food processing, pharmaceuticals, and manufacturing, to benefit from increased efficiency.
